Output 424ca4e160c9db389fb03c369d990c6ea245c979ccc68b675554413c8d6fce34:7

value
12571756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bfa6a6adb3a90c15c7ab5443694bf4421f0b9bc OP_EQUAL
address
35hYxynS8YfYafsAzmcAzyXxL6nVvMKWFK
transaction
424ca4e160c9db389fb03c369d990c6ea245c979ccc68b675554413c8d6fce34